THE EPIC OF THE STEPPES

Patrick Fischmann and Michel Abraham : chant, luth tovshuur, vièle morin khuur, briningam, shruti-box, guimbarde, flûte, tambour...

With an immense landscape of steppes, mountains and deserts, from the Altai mountains to the Gobi Desert, Mongolia is one the largest countries with a prominent shamanic tradition. Patrick Fischmann and Michel Abraham take us to the legendary lands where man is both the son of the wolf and the brother of camels, horses and marmots; the blind bard swears he is a clairvoyant; a shaman’s son saves Khan’s daughter and the wolf-man becomes a princess’s companion.

Songs, which are omnipresent, bear witness to human beings’ celestial origins and the mysteries behind the tales and legends. In these unique stories, bards, heroes, shamans, stars, animals, magicians and chiefs interact. These parables are captured and carried by spellbinding music and are accompanied by the sounds of the ‘goat’s head fiddle’, the lute, the Jew’s harp, horn and the Mongolian flute.
